CHANGES TO DEPENDANT PRIVILEGES FOR WORK PASS HOLDERS (2018)

As part of periodic updating, MOM has reviewed the qualifying salary criteria for work pass holders to qualify for dependant privileges. This is to ensure that main pass holders are able to upkeep their dependants in Singapore.

From 1 January 2018:

  • Work pass holders need to meet a minimum fixed monthly salary of $6,000 to bring in their spouse/children (on Dependant’s Pass).
  • Work pass holders need to meet a minimum fixed monthly salary of $12,000 to bring in their parents (on Long Term Visit Pass).

New Dependant’s Pass (DP) applications for spouse/children and Long Term Visit Pass (LTVP) applications for parents received before 1 January 2018 will be assessed on existing criteria.

Renewal DPs/LTVPs approved or issued before 1 January 2018 will also be assessed on existing criteria as long as the main pass holder holds a valid work pass with the same employer.
